About
Material Type: Sandstone
Origin:PolandPoland (Kielce, Malopolska)
Priamry Color(s): Beige
Recommended Usage:Construction stone, ornamental stone
Additional Names:Kilzinger,Kilzinger Sandstein

Can Poland's Kielce Sandstone be used in a bathroom?

Yes, Polands Kielce Sandstone can be used in a bathroom. It is a durable and versatile material, making it suitable for various applications, including bathroom countertops, sinks, shower walls, and flooring. However, it is important to consider the porosity of sandstone and take proper care to prevent staining and water damage. Regular sealing and maintenance may be necessary to ensure its longevity in a bathroom setting.

Are there color variations of Poland's Kielce Sandstone?

Yes, Polands Kielce Sandstone can vary in color from beige to yellow, gray, pink, and even red-brown. The color variation is due to the different mineral content in the rock as well as the various weathering and aging effects.

What is the average flexural strength of Poland's Kielce Sandstone?

The average flexural strength of Polands Kielce Sandstone can vary depending on various factors such as the specific quarry and the quality of the stone. However, a common range for the flexural strength of Kielce Sandstone is between 10 and 15 MPa (megapascals).

Can Poland's Kielce Sandstone be used exterior applications in very humid climates?

Polands Kielce Sandstone is generally suitable for exterior applications in humid climates, but it is important to consider a few factors before making a final decision. 1. Porosity: Kielce Sandstone is a relatively porous material, meaning it has small spaces within its structure that can absorb moisture. In humid climates, where there may be frequent rain or high humidity, this porosity can lead to the stone absorbing water and potentially causing issues such as staining, efflorescence, or even crumbling over time. Applying a sealant or water repellent coating can help mitigate these risks. 2. Freeze-thaw cycles: If the humid climate also experiences freezing temperatures, its crucial to consider the potential effects of freeze-thaw cycles on Kielce Sandstone. Water that gets absorbed into the stone can freeze and expand, leading to cracks, spalling, or other forms of damage. Choosing a stone with higher density and lower porosity or using proper installation techniques, such as providing adequate drainage, can help minimize this risk. 3. Maintenance: Humid climates often have more vegetation growth, moss, or algae due to the moisture in the air. Its important to consider the maintenance requirements of Kielce Sandstone in such conditions. Regular cleaning and removal of any organic growth may be necessary to preserve the stones appearance and prevent potential damages. Ultimately, proper installation, maintenance, and considering the specific properties of Kielce Sandstone can make it suitable for exterior applications in very humid climates. Consulting with professionals or suppliers experienced in working with this type of stone is recommended to ensure its suitability for a specific project.
